If You have ever dabbled on this planet of Search engine optimisation or digital advertising, you've got probably heard of backlinks. They are the lifeblood of search engine rankings, the golden ticket which can help your site soar to the very best of Google’s search engine results. But not https://chancelrwx566875.shotblogs.com/not-known-facts-about-50386559
Backlinks Blog Comments Things To Know Before You Get This
Internet - 1 hour 49 minutes ago johnb085tze9Web Directory Categories
Web Directory Search
New Site Listings